You forgot Hassan Kamel Al-Sabbah, There're hundreds of innovations linked to him, he died in a car accident in the USA but his body was not injured (which is very weird in my opinion), he registered 26 innovations individually and 9 with partners. and you forgot Rammal Hassan Rammal, condensed matter physicist. He was born in Doueir. He was the top student in his class. He graduated high school and ranked first place in the official exams of the baccalaureate Section II (general science) in Lebanon. He won The Rammal Award for scientists from Mediterranean countries was created in his honor by the EuroScience organization and has been awarded annually since 1993. Rammal Rammal high school was built in his hometown Doueir for his honor. The science and research States magazine awarded him in 1984, the smallest researcher in the world of his generation. the French government awarded him a silver medal for Scientific Research. the French magazine Le Point named him among the top twenty French characters who will play an important role in changing France in the 2000s. the National Center for Scientific Research awarded him a bronze medal in 1984, in recognition of the best doctoral thesis in France.
